The Green, West Auckland, County Durham DL14 9HW
A quintessential English manor house steeped in history, this charming residence presents itself as the ideal destination for a relaxing country break in the historic county of Durham. Built on foundations which date back to the 12th Century, the hotel is reputed to have been Henry VIII???s hunting lodge and home to the Eden family. It houses secret passages and even a friendly ghost or two! Set in its own landscaped grounds and equipped with multi-functional rooms and a spa, it is an ideal base for exploring Northumbria's many castles, cathedrals and the Roman Wall.

Flass Vale, Waddington Street, Durham, County Durham DH1 4BG
Kings Lodge Hotel, with its prestigious Knight's Restaurant, is set in the heart of Durham City. A site which once echoed to the sounds of battle now provides a setting for comfortable and tasteful residence. Kings Lodge stands at the South East entrance to Flass Vale, an urban nature reserve on the edge of the site of the famous battle of Nevilles Cross at which, in 1346, the invading army of King David of Scotland was beaten off by English troops led by Ralph Neville and Henry Percy.
